** About Ameren Missouri
** Ameren Missouri has been providing electric and gas service for more than 100 years, and our electric rates are among the lowest in the nation. Ameren Missouri's mission is to power the quality of life for our 1.2 million electric and 132,000 natural gas customers in central and eastern Missouri. Our service area covers 64 counties and more than 500 communities including the greater St.

Louis area.

Visit our  Page for more information on benefits provided to regular full-time employees. About The Position  The Supervisor, Laboratory supports the operations of the Ameren Missouri laboratory in the role of a supervisor and chemist.

Key responsibilities include:

● Report and interpret analytical results, analyze facility problems, provide recommendations, and approve data and technical reports.  
● Investigate and solve problems with analytical instruments (including ICP, IC, ICPMS, IR, GC, and HPLC) and methodology.  
● Develop analytical methods, procedures, and business processes for the laboratory to ensure accuracy of testing results, efficient and cost-effective utilization of resources, and customer satisfaction.  
● Supervise chemistry technicians at the central laboratory and across the other laboratories in Ameren Missouri Power Operations.  
● Review and develop training material for training laboratory technicians and others as necessary.
● Train chemistry technicians on central laboratory and plant chemistry procedures.  Train chemistry technicians on power plant chemistry principals and water treating equipment operation.  
● Consult with customers, including energy centers, on chemistry-related processes.  
● Specify and select laboratory equipment and supplies.
Qualifications  Bachelor’s Degree in Chemistry from an accredited college or university required. Master’s Degree in Chemistry from an accredited college or university preferred. Five or more years of relevant experience in analytical chemistry required. Supervisory or team leadership experience preferred. Experience in the electric utility industry also preferred.
In addition to the above qualifications, the successful candidate will demonstrate:  Must be proficient in the use of PC-based applications, including spreadsheets, graphics, word processing, and database software preferred.

Good analytical , communication, human relations, and customer service skills required. Must be able to wear a respirator. Must be able to operate a motor vehicle and have a valid driver’s license.
